Quincey made us fall in love with the Golden Retriever breed. Everything from their demeanor, obedience, and that floppy tongue smile – it’s no wonder why they are such a popular dog! After having Quincey for about 6 months, Brad and I already wanted another one to join the family! We both agreed that it was the perfect time in our lives to get a puppy.

Shopping for puppies is quite possibly the best thing ever. It’s hard though at the same time, you want to take them all home with you!! We searched through azcentral’s website for local breeders that were selling puppies. Our first stop just didn’t feel right. Don’t get me wrong, the puppies were adorable – but we just didn’t have “that feeling”. Our second stop I had called before, and the women I spoke to was really sweet, and asked me several questions to make sure we were the right fit for her puppies as well. She even had one in mind that she thought would be perfect for our personality. We drove at least an hour to far east Queen Creek and arrived to a home with 6 adorable puppies in a baby play pen. A couple were barking, a couple were jumping up trying to get out, but there was one sweet gentle puppy sitting and looking up at me with big brown eyes. It was love at first sight! Coincidentally, it was the same puppy the breeder was going to suggest for us. It was meant to be šŸ™‚

We bought her on the spot, and made the long drive back. I was jealous because I had to drive and Brad got to hold her. Here is her first photo from that car ride, sitting on Brad’s lap.

We named her Roxy – Quincey got a new sister and friend for life!

The Golden that started it all..

Quincey arrives

On January 9, 2010 – our lives were forever changed by the arrival of a beautiful Golden Retriever named Quincey! Quincey has a very special story on how he came into our lives..

Jake Kloberdanz, a very close friend and CEO of ONEHOPE Wine, attended a charity event in Los Angeles during the fall of 2009 where they were auctioning off several items to fundraise for the cause. One of the top items was a beautiful purebred 2 year old male Golden Retriever, who had also received over $5,000 in service dog training. Jake, having spent most of his childhood with a Golden Retriever, grew immediately attached to this dog. Jake knew from the moment he saw the dog that it just had to be a part of his life, and as a result Jake placed the highest bid! Jake was the proud winner of Quincey, and was excited to give the dog to his parents as an early Christmas parents. Fun Story: what Jake paid the charity for Quincey funded anĀ underprivilegedĀ child to attend a summer camp.

Jake drove Quincey from Los Angeles to his parents’ home in Fremont (San Francisco bay area) and surprised them with a beautiful Golden Retriever. His parents immediately fell in love Quincey, but also knew that it was not the right time for them to take on a young dog. Of course Quincey started to grab a lot of attention in Jake’s parents’ neighborhood, and received several adoption requests.Ā Jake called me and was distraught over the situation, not knowing where Quincey would go. He really wanted him to be with his family or a close friend so that he could still be a part of his life. All of a sudden, the solution became so clear: We would adopt Quincey! Brad and I had been talking about wanting a dog, so this couldn’t have been more perfect timing.

So now – how do we get Quincey from Northern California to Phoenix? Luckily, Jake’s parents were driving to San Diego and my cousin Jenny Gautreau was driving from Southern California to Arizona for my bachelorette party the very same weekend. Jenny had just gotten a beautiful brand new white Mercedes, so bless her heart for transporting a 65 lb Golden in it! Quincey arrived at our home and into our lives on January 9th. The picture above was taken just moments after he arrived to his new home in Scottsdale.

We didn’t know it at the time, but Brad and I were on our way to be the biggest Golden Retriever lovers in the world! We are so thankful to Jake and his parents Jane & Frank for bringing Quincey into our lives.
